Deadline extended for submission of proposals for the sustainable mobility challenge
The eCitySevilla project is extending the deadline for the submission of proposals for the last challenge, on the provision of a sustainable mobility service to transport users from the future peripheral car park located in the area of the Banqueta de la Isla de la Cartuja, to the inside of the fenced enclosure, and vice versa.
Companies or groups of companies interested in participating must present a proposal that includes an innovative solution, using a single means of sustainable transport or a combination of several. In any case, the service must ensure that the user does not take more than 15 minutes to reach their destination (whether work, study or other purposes) from the time they park their vehicle, and no more than 15 minutes to return to the car park. The cost of the service should also be affordable, ideally not exceeding €1 per day.
The car park will have a capacity of approximately 2,500 cars and will have charging points for all types of electric vehicles. Therefore, the shuttle service must be in accordance with the forecasts for the filling and emptying process of these spaces. It is expected that most of the vehicles will enter in the morning between 7am and 9.30am, with a peak between 7.45am and 8.45am, while the exit is expected to take place progressively between 2pm and 3.30pm (around 2,000 places) and the remaining 500 between 3.30pm and 8pm.
